The most professional thing we can do for students is to prepare them for a job market that doesn’t fully exist yet. By the time an 8-year-old enters the workforce, they won’t just be “using” AI; they will be Collaborating with it. We call this the “Centaur Model”—half human, half machine, working together to be better than either could be alone.
New jobs are appearing every day:
Prompt Engineers: Who “whisper” to AI to get perfect results.
AI Trainers: Who teach machines how to be polite and accurate.
Data Curators: Who find the “clean” information that AI needs to learn.
However, the “10/10” insight is that Human Skills are becoming more valuable, not less. As AI handles the data and the logic, humans are needed for Empathy, Leadership, and Complex Ethics. A robot can write a legal contract, but it can’t argue a case in front of a judge with passion. A robot can suggest a medical treatment, but it can’t hold a patient’s hand and give them hope. We want students to focus on their “Humanity” as their greatest career asset.
